This event aims to identify practical steps to better and more systematically integrate standardisation into relevant MSCA projects, by presenting relevant policies, successful cases, stakeholder perspectives, and existing tools, networks and matchmaking platforms.

Programme in brief

  • 13:30 - 13:35 Welcome
  • 13:35 - 14:10 Bridging R&I and standardization: EU policy objectives
  • 14:10 - 14:20 Concrete case, the MSCA Career-Fit Plus Fellowship Programme
  • 14:20 - 14:30 Recommendations from the MSP Task Force on bridging R&I and standardization, MSCA Working Group
  • 14:30 – 15:15 Promoting and encouraging researchers’ involvement into standardization: stakeholders’ viewpoints and activities
  • 15:15 - 15:30 Coffee break
  • 15:30 – 16:10 Examples of existing tools and relays at EU level for training and matchmaking
  • 16:10 – 16:40 Moving forward in concrete terms: launching a pilot on quantum
  • 16:40 – 17:20 Wrap up: how to involve MSCA fellows into standardization in a more systemic way? Panel discussion
  • 17:20 – 17:30 Conclusion

ATHENA - Cybersecurity for the water sector

The ATHENA project addresses emerging risks for the water sector in operational technology created by digitalisation. The project responds to Digital Europe call DIGITAL-ECCC-2022-CYBER-03-UPTAKE-CYBERSOLUTIONS – Uptake op Innovative Cybersecurity Solutions. The project started in September 2023 and will run until November 2026. De Vlaamse Waterweg - The Flemish Waterway participates in the project to enhance the resilience of the organisation by co-developing targeted training modules for operational technology environments.
